Latest Patents

Among his latest innovations are two notable patents: a 3D glasses driving method and a display apparatus that utilizes 3D glasses. The 3D glasses driving method involves receiving a sync signal from an external device and determining the duty of a driving signal that alternates the opening and closing of the left and right eye glasses of the 3D shutter glasses. This method allows users to view 3D images with improved brightness while minimizing crosstalk. The display apparatus includes a display panel and a light source unit with multiple division areas that are independently driven. This design enables the lighting period of the division areas to be adjusted based on the type of image signal displayed, enhancing the overall viewing experience.
